最近的项目中使用了很多第三方插件,在此简单记录一下,本篇文章会长期更新。
有必要将一些优秀的插件推荐给大家,先挖个坑,以后有时间会找其中比较优秀的插件写一写深入解析的文章。
大家比较熟知的框架和插件,比如jQuery、bootstrap在此略过。
saveSvgAsPng
github:saveSvgAsPng
saveSvgAsPng可以很方便的将网页中的**<svg>标签另存为.png格式的图片。saveSvgAsPng的原理是将svg的内容绘制到canvas中,让后将canvas的dataUrl绑定到一个<a>标签的href属性中,触发<a>**标签的的click事件下载图片。
1 | // 使用方法: |
TableExport
::TODO